Data Sheet ADuCM342 Integrated, Precision Battery Sensor for Automotive Systems FEATURES ► High precision ADCs ► Dual-channel, simultaneous sampling ► IADC 20-bit Σ-Δ (minimizes range switching) ► VADC/TADC 20-bit Σ-Δ ► Programmable ADC conversion rate from 4 Hz to 8 kHz ► On-chip ±5 ppm/°C voltage reference ► Current channel ► Fully differential, buffered input ► Programmable-gain (from 4 to 512) ► ADC absolute input range: −200 mV to +300 mV ► Digital comparator with current accumulator feature ► Voltage channel ► Buffered, on-chip attenuator for 12 V battery input ► Temperature channel ► External and on-chip temperature sensor options ► Microcontroller ► ARM Cortex-M3 32-bit processor ► 16.
